Bergen Community College is accepting applications for adjunct positions in the Radiography department for Fall and Winter 2026. 

Radiography Department:

The Bergen Community College Radiography Program cultivates graduates who possess knowledge, clinical competence, ethics, and meet the needs of a diverse community. The program uses engagement and collaboration to help instruct radiography principles that are integral to health care.

Responsibilities: 

  • Be knowledgeable of program goals, clinical objectives and the clinical evaluation system. 
  • Provide didactic, laboratory, and/or clinical instruction to students in the radiography program. 
  • Provides supervision over the student in the clinical/lab setting. 
  • Keeps attendance and assigns students in their clinical rotations. 
  • Implements the Trajectsus clinical tracking program during all clinical rotations. 
  • Evaluates student clinical/lab skills utilizing the program evaluation form. 
  • Provides constructive feedback to students regarding overall progress. 
  • Assesses and reports the student’s progress to the Program Director and Clinical Coordinator. 
  • Enforces the program policies, rules and regulations and documents violations and disciplinary action taken. 
  • Provides a positive learning environment for student development and success. 
  • Participates in the adjunct faculty conferences and radiography program faculty meetings. 
  • Participates in the outcomes assessment process. 
  • Adheres to contractual obligations.

Qualifications: 

  • Graduate of a JRCERT accredited education program in Radiologic Technology. 
  • Current NJ Radiography license required. 
  • Holds a current certification and registration in Radiography from the ARRT. 
  • Minimum of five years of current clinical experience. 
  • Teaching experience is preferred but not mandatory. 

Rates and Benefits:

  • Adjunct rates range from $922 to $960. The pay rates are $938 a credit for adjuncts who have obtained an Associates, $950 for a Bachelor's and $960 for a Master's. 
  • Tuition Waiver for BCC courses for themselves or their dependents
  • ABP and 403b
